Manager, Bus Safety & Security
Job Purpose
Reporting to both Dy MD Buses and Head of Strides, Safety & Security functionally, the Manager, Bus Safety & Security, is responsible for ensuring the safe operations of buses operations and enforcing Traffic Safety and Workplace Safety and Health (WSH) standards within the company.
Responsibilities
Regulatory Compliance & Safety Standards
- Ensure compliance with regulatory and contractual safety requirements set by the Land Transport Authority (LTA).
- Maintain and uphold the ISO 39001 standard for Road Traffic Safety Management.
- Keep the Bus Safety Management System updated across all relevant departments.
Safety Planning & Risk Management
- Develop and implement an annual Bus Safety Work Plan, including Safety Key Performance Indicators (KPIs).
- Identify, assess, and mitigate risks to enhance safety in bus operations.
- Direct in the investigation of traffic and Workplace Safety & Health (WSH) accidents, providing recommendations for corrective actions.
Accident Analysis
- Maintain a digitalized database of accident cases for data analysis and trend identification.
- Analyse accident reports to determine root causes and propose preventive measures.
Safety Awareness & Engagement
- Drive Traffic Safety and WSH programs within bus operations to promote a strong safety culture among employees.
- Provide expert safety management advice to internal departments and key stakeholders.
- Collaborate with authorities and agencies to conduct Public Safety Awareness Engagements.
Technology & Data-Driven Safety Enhancements
- Evaluate and implement technology solutions to enhance bus operational safety.
